200 years later, they still stand.

These traditional Kumaoni homes were built from stone, timber, lime and mud by generations who understood the mountains intimately.

The ground floor housed cattle during the harsh winters. Families lived above. Small internal openings connected the two levels, allowing warmth, food and daily life to flow through the house without stepping outside.

Many of these homes are now unoccupied, yet the village continues to care for them. Walls are replastered, woodwork is preserved and annual whitewashing keeps them standing as reminders of a way of life that shaped Kumaon for centuries.

In Peora, heritage remains part of the landscape.
